We purchased a new Lexus at this dealership a few months earlier and really liked the salesperson Dan J. I was completely blown away upon my first trip to the service department. Think Walmart at Christmas time and that's the quality of service I received. They have a "greeter" who needs to trade in his tux for some lessons in common courtesy. The service person (Dave B) needs to also enroll in that class. The reason for my visit - I had a problem with the dye from the new floor mats apparently not being colorfast and coming off - causing the installed carpet and other areas near the carpet to get black. I realized after a few months of repeated cleanings that it was the poor quality mats causing the problem - I could rub my hands across them and get black on my fingers. The service person made repeated inferences that I was just getting my carpets dirty, and then told me all the mats were like that as far as color coming off and showed me another vehicle in for repair that had dirty carpet near the pedal. I was quite astonished to hear him say that Lexus in their $65,000 vehicle couldn't come up with quality floor mats. He suggested I could buy the rubber ones. REALLY ?! Rubber mats more appropriate for a truck at my expense? As another man at the computer checked the price of the mats, the service person walked off without a word. After that I drove immediately to the Arrowhead Lexus where I was treated MUCH better. They tried to come up with a solution and the outstanding worker there (Eddie) offered to power wash the mats and clean the carpet (and wash the car) to see if that worked. If not, they told me to bring the vehicle back in. Obviously I will be going there for future service.
